Wilson To Be Involved In Sonic Arena Effort

It was announced this week that Seahawk quarterback Russell Wilson will partner with Bay Area hedge fund manager Chris Hansen in an effort to bring NBA basketball back to Seattle. 
The CBS NBA site writes that there are rumors of a possible NBA expansion with the possibility of a new Seattle franchise.  That would probably be a much better scenario for the image conscious Wilson rather than being know for efforts to relocate another city's team. 
The association with Wilson, brings local respect to a group that has most recently gotten a cold shoulder from Seattle leaders.  Much of that due to word that Hansen was involved in efforts to stop the building of an arena in Sacramento, where a few years ago, Hansen was almost able to buy the Kings and relocate the team. 
Bringing an NHL franchise to the city was another goal of the Hansen group.
